أَخْبَرَنَا وَكِيعٌ، نا عَبْدُ الْحَمِيدِ بْنُ بَهْرَامَ، عَنْ شَهْرِ بْنِ حَوْشَبٍ، عَنْ أَسْمَاءَ بِنْتِ يَزِيدَ عَنْ رَسُولِ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 قَالَ: ((مَنِ ارْتَبَطَ فَرَسًا فِي سَبِيلِ اللَّهِ فَأَنْفَقَ عَلَيْهِ احْتِسَابًا، فَإِنَّ شِبَعَهُ وَجُوعَهُ وَظَمَأَهُ وَرِيَّهُ وَبَوْلَهُ وَرَوْثَهُ فِي مِيزَانِهِ يَوْمَ الْقِيَامَةِ)).
Sayyida Asma bint Yazid (may Allah be pleased with her) narrated from the Messenger of Allah (peace and blessings be upon him), he said: "Whoever ties a horse in the way of Allah (for jihad), and spends on it with the intention of reward, then its being full, its being hungry, its being thirsty, its being quenched, and its urination and defecation will all be in his scale (of deeds) on the Day of Judgment."
